Tomcat預設工具manager管理頁面訪問配置

2022-08-17 06:12:23 字數 1304 閱讀 1912

…略…

-->

rolename="manager-gui"/>

rolename="manager-script"/>

rolename="manager-jmx"/>

rolename="manager-status"/>

rolename="admin-gui"/>

rolename="admin-script"/>

username="tomcat" password="tomcat" roles="manager-gui,manager-script,manager-jmx,manager-status,admin-gui,admin-script"/>

>

此處可以配置多個角色,不同版本tomcat所擁有的角色都不同,在生產環境中建議修改複雜度高的tomcat使用者密碼,另外不需要分配所有角色許可權,經需要夠用的即可,如果不能訪問會用相應的提示,在配置好後此時再開啟tomcat的首頁還是無法進入tomcat的管理頁面的

因為從tomcat 7開始安全機制下預設僅允許本機訪問tomcat,如需遠端訪問tomcat的管理頁面還需要配置相應的ip允許規則,配置manager的contest.xml可以在$/conf/catalina/localhost目錄下配置2個contest.xml檔案,也可以寫成乙個,但是建議寫成2個便於日常的許可權管理,如下:

manager.xml:

privileged="true" antiresourcelocking="false"

classname="org.apache.catalina.valves.remoteaddrvalve" allow="^192.168.*$" />

>

host-manager.xml:

privileged="true" antiresourcelocking="false"

classname="org.apache.catalina.valves.remoteaddrvalve" allow="^192.168.*$" />

>

其中allow中是填ip可以使用正規表示式匹配,在內網中建議寫成匹配某某網段可以訪問的形式,如此tomcat的manager頁面訪問配置就完成了

tomcat 更改預設目錄

1.修改的 安裝好tomcat後,想另開乙個目錄來存放jsp檔案,而不願意放在tomcat的目錄下。例如 你想把你的jsp檔案放在 var wwwroot的資料夾裡。你希望輸入 就能訪問到 var wwwroot裡的jsp檔案。那就必須要修改tomcat的預設執行jsp的目錄了。開啟tomcat的s...

tomcat 配置預設專案

windows server.xml host 標籤下 加上這一句即可 path裡面不能是 在windows下,會使配置無效 linux 好像是需要有斜槓的 具體原因,暫未查明 path的值 空值 斜槓 似乎是一樣的結果 另外可以指定war檔案,使其自動解壓到path所指向的路徑 tomcat 7 ...

修改 Tomcat 預設首頁

2 修改 conf 目錄下的 server.xml 檔案,找到 標籤,然後新增 如下 name localhost unpackwars true autodeploy true documentation at docs config valve.html classname org.apache...